Connecticut paystub law

What Connecticut law actually requires on a paystub.

Wage statement requirements

Connecticut General Statutes § 31-13a requires every employer to furnish a record of hours worked, gross earnings, itemized deductions, and net earnings to each employee with each wage payment. The Connecticut Department of Labor enforces wage payment laws; willful failure to pay wages is a Class D felony. Connecticut also enforces strict pay-transparency disclosure requirements (§ 31-40z) covering wage ranges in postings and during the application process, which is separate from but related to paystub requirements.

Using a Connecticut paystub for proof of income

Connecticut's high-cost rental markets (Fairfield County commuter towns like Stamford, Greenwich, Westport) routinely require gross income at 3× monthly rent or higher, plus a year of W-2s for stability. Finance and insurance workers in Hartford and Stamford receive standard institutional paystubs. Many landlords in Fairfield County use professional screening services (TransUnion SmartMove, RentSpree) that pull data systematically rather than just reviewing the stub manually.
